Powernext gas futures to launch on November 26
Physical contracts will be cleared by European Commodity Clearing (ECC), the first time a German clearing house has been used by a French exchange. ECC is owned by European Energy Exchange (EEX). The clearing arrangement is part of a wider cooperation deal between EEX and Powernext in the electricity markets.
Powernext has secured five unidentified market participants to create the liquidity necessary to establish reliable pricing.
